I'm totally frustrated trying to figure out how to anchor text in a 'form' so
that when you add a form field it doesn't keep scrolling the rest of the form
off the page. I've tried 'continous break' and read all the stuff on working
w/lines etc. in some of the other posts but am having no success with
'tables' or 'text boxes'. Anybody know how to do it?
 
Most people create forms using a table structure (it can be borderless),
with preferred column widths (auto resizing disabled) and exact row heights.
